Compare commits
No commits in common. "ea95fdec97ff7f5474ec4370e75e3b7dfdfaf943" and "615896c466bde905e329c6c155413b94ad349931" have entirely different histories.
ea95fdec97
...
615896c466
2 changed files with 16 additions and 8 deletions
|
@ -17,7 +17,7 @@ case $1 in
|
||||||
[[ -n $serverurl ]]
|
[[ -n $serverurl ]]
|
||||||
pass="$(gopass show --password docker/$serverurl)"
|
pass="$(gopass show --password docker/$serverurl)"
|
||||||
login="$(gopass show --password docker/$serverurl login)"
|
login="$(gopass show --password docker/$serverurl login)"
|
||||||
jo serverurl=$serverurl username=$login secret=$pass
|
jo serverurl=dhub.corp.metrans.cz username=$login secret=$pass
|
||||||
exit ;;
|
exit ;;
|
||||||
store)
|
store)
|
||||||
jq '.username+"|"+.secret+"|"+.serverurl' | IFS='|' read login secret serverurl
|
jq '.username+"|"+.secret+"|"+.serverurl' | IFS='|' read login secret serverurl
|
||||||
|
|
|
@ -3,16 +3,25 @@ set -e
|
||||||
|
|
||||||
last_dir_file=/run/user/1000/rofi-fb.last-dir
|
last_dir_file=/run/user/1000/rofi-fb.last-dir
|
||||||
|
|
||||||
|
if (( ROFI_RETV == 0 ))
|
||||||
if [[ -n "$ROFI_DATA" ]] && [[ -d "$ROFI_DATA" ]]
|
|
||||||
then
|
then
|
||||||
cd "$ROFI_DATA"
|
# echo "first call" >&2
|
||||||
|
rm -f /run/user/1000/rofi-fb.last-dir
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
if [[ -e "$last_dir_file" ]]
|
||||||
|
then
|
||||||
|
ld="$(cat "$last_dir_file")"
|
||||||
|
# echo "change to $ld" >&2
|
||||||
|
[[ -d "$ld" ]] && cd "$ld"
|
||||||
|
fi
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
if [[ -d "$1" ]]
|
if [[ -d "$1" ]]
|
||||||
then
|
then
|
||||||
cd "$1"
|
cd "$1"
|
||||||
echo -e "\0data\x1f$(pwd)"
|
echo "$PWD" > "$last_dir_file"
|
||||||
elif [[ -x "$1" ]]
|
elif [[ -x "$1" ]]
|
||||||
then
|
then
|
||||||
"$1"
|
"$1"
|
||||||
|
@ -24,7 +33,6 @@ then
|
||||||
exit 0
|
exit 0
|
||||||
fi
|
fi
|
||||||
|
|
||||||
echo -e "\0message\x1f$(pwd)"
|
echo ".."
|
||||||
echo "../"
|
ls -A
|
||||||
ls -A1 --file-type --group-directories-first
|
|
||||||
# vim:sw=4:ts=4:et:
|
# vim:sw=4:ts=4:et:
|
||||||
|
|
Loading…
Add table
Reference in a new issue